Senior high school students time management survey

Explore the world of time management among senior high school students with this informative survey.

1. I prioritize my studying over social activities.

2. I have a set schedule for studying and homework.

3. I procrastinate on completing assignments.

4. I am able to balance my extracurricular activities with my academics.

5. I frequently study past midnight.

6. I utilize study breaks effectively.

7. I seek help from teachers or classmates when needed.

8. I tend to underestimate the time needed to complete tasks.

9. I use a planner or organizer to keep track of assignments and deadlines.

10. I find it challenging to say no to social invitations during busy study periods.

11. I feel overwhelmed by the amount of workload or assignments.

12. I tend to multitask while studying.

13. I set specific goals for my academic performance.

14. I make use of technology for better time management (e.g., apps, reminders).

15. I tend to leave assignments or studying until the last minute.

16. I struggle with setting priorities when it comes to my academics.

17. I have a designated study space that is free from distractions.

18. I track my progress and adjust study habits accordingly.

19. I feel like I have control over my time and schedule.

20. I dedicate specific times for relaxation and self-care amidst academic pressures.

Assessing Senior High School Students' Time Management Skills

Are senior high school students effectively managing their time to enhance academic performance? Our survey titled 'Senior high school students time management survey' seeks to analyze the time management habits of senior high school students in relation to their academic performance. The questionnaire consists of 20 insightful questions designed to assess various aspects of time management, ranging from study habits to priority setting. By offering respondents the options of 'always,' 'sometimes,' 'rarely,' 'often,' and 'never,' we aim to gain a comprehensive understanding of how students perceive and approach time management in their academic lives. The survey covers a wide range of topics, including procrastination, study schedules, extracurricular activities, workload management, and the utilization of study tools like planners and technology. The insights gathered from this survey can provide valuable data for educators, school administrators, and parents to support students in improving their time management skills and academic outcomes.
